Political party in Croatia


Bandić Milan 365 – Labour and Solidarity Party (Croatian: Bandić Milan 365 – Stranka rada i solidarnosti or BM 365) is a political party in Croatia founded in 2015 by then Mayor of Zagreb Milan Bandić.

History

The party was founded in Zagreb on 28 March 2015 by then Mayor of Zagreb Milan Bandić and his associates.[5][6][7]

In the 2015 parliamentary election, the party participated with 13 coalition partners, won 2 seats in the Croatian Parliament, and eventually signed coalition agreement with the centre-right Patriotic Coalition and Bridge of Independent Lists (MOST), voting in favor of approving Cabinet of Tihomir Orešković.[8] In the 2016 parliamentary election, BM 365 retained 1 MP who voted in favor of approving Cabinet of Andrej Plenković.

Following the death of Milan Bandić on 28 February 2021, the party's vice-president Jelena Pavičić Vukičević became the acting president.[9][10] On 11 December Slavko Kojić was elected as new president of the party, replacing Pavičić Vukičević.[11]
